F.I.T. (Fitness Iniative Targeting )Kids Program:

A cardiovascular risk screening program targeting fifth grade students in Charlevoix and Antrim County.  The program consists of education in the areas of cardiovascular risk factors (nutrition, physical activity, family history), a physical screening for cholesterol, BMI, blood pressure, diabetes and aerobic activity, and post screening education discussing results and encouraging healthy lifestyle activities.  F.I.T. Kids is an interactive program to raise health awareness in both the children and their families, while at the same time providing a "fun" educational experience that will hopefully last a lifetime.

Read to Me:

Books are provided to Boyne City, Charlevoix, East Jordan, and Beaver Island Doctors' offices to give to parents during well child exams to encourage reading with their children.  Over 1,000 books were distributed this year.

Newborn/Infant hospital bags and books:

A joint effort with the Charlevoix Public Library to provide new parents with bags, books, and health information pamphlets at the time of hospital discharge.  Also, books are provided to young children admitted to the hospital.

Worksite Wellness:

Health screenings provided to local worksites which include cholesterol, glucose, blood pressure, body mass index, and health history screenings.

Brown Bag Lunches:

30-45 minute educational discussions provided during employee lunchtimes.

Community Educational Events

Health presentations provided to community members at the Charlevoix Public Library.  Topics include Daibetes and Glycemic Index, Colorectal Cancer(with free screening and testing), Arthritis, Breast Cancer, and Cardiovascular Disease. Leukemia/Lymphoma presentations via REMEC.

S.O.S.(sight on success):

Collaborative event with Charlevoix Zonta Club, providing education to Charlevoix County middle school girls in the areas of self esteem, goal setting, and confidence building.
